Introduction:
Providing the best care to our pets is essential to their well being. Many pet owners are turning to homemade pet food recipes to make sure their pets are getting the nutrition they need. You can make your own meals for your pets at home, as you have complete control over the ingredients. We'll show you some delicious and healthy homemade pet food recipes that are sure to make your pets happy.
1 Chicken and vegetable stir Fry.
There are ingredients.
2 skinless chicken breasts.
A cup of mixed vegetables.
1 cup of rice.
1 part olive oil to 1 part water.
Instructions
1 The chicken breasts should be cooked in a skillet. Set aside the skillet.
2 Add the vegetables and olive oil to the skillet. Cook for about 7 minutes.
3 Add the cooked chicken to the skillet by cutting it into bite-sized pieces.
4 The brown rice should be mixed well.
5 Allow the mixture to cool before serving it.
Before cooking chicken for your pet, make sure to remove any seasonings.

3 Pumpkin and peanut butter are treats.
There are ingredients.
1 cup pumpkin puree.
1/2 cup of peanut butter.
Whole wheat flour is 2 1/2 cups.
Instructions
1 The oven should be at 350F (175C).
2 Pumpkin puree and peanut butter can be combined in a bowl.
3 Gradually add the whole wheat flour, mixing well after each addition, until the dough is no longer sticky.
4 The dough should be rolled out to a thickness of about a quarter-inch.
5 Cut the dough into small squares with cookie cutters.
6 The treats should be placed on a baking sheet.
7 They should be golden brown by the time they are baked.
8 Allow the treats to cool completely before giving them to your pet.
